The political landscape just took a sharp turn. On Sunday, President Donald Trump posted a scorcher of an AI video that may mark the start of a major reckoning. The video features top Democrats like Barack Obama, Nancy Pelosi, Elizabeth Warren, and Letitia James all parroting the line, “No one is above the law”—before cutting to an image of Obama being led away in handcuffs, set to the Village People’s “YMCA.”

The video’s release came just days after Director of National Intelligence Tulsi Gabbard unveiled a trove of more than 100 documents allegedly proving that the entire Russia collusion narrative was a “treasonous conspiracy” directed by then-President Barack Obama. According to Gabbard, the plot was hatched in the waning days of Obama’s presidency—after Trump had already been elected—and it targeted not just the incoming president, but the very foundation of the U.S. democratic system.

“These documents detail and provide evidence of how this treasonous conspiracy was directed by President Obama,” Gabbard told Fox’s Maria Bartiromo on Sunday Morning Futures. “This is not a Democrat or Republican issue. This is about the integrity of our democratic republic.”

Even more explosive, Gabbard confirmed she’s making criminal referrals to the Department of Justice and says multiple whistleblowers are now coming forward to reveal what really happened. “Whistleblowers are coming out of the woodwork,” she said, warning that the full scope of corruption hasn’t yet been made public—but will be soon.
